What is 60/22 Divided By 2/4

Answer: 6022÷24\frac{60}{22}\div\frac{2}{4} = 6011\frac{60}{11}

Solving 6022÷24\frac{60}{22}\div\frac{2}{4}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

6022÷24=6022×42\frac{60}{22} \div \frac{2}{4} = \frac{60}{22} \times \frac{4}{2}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 60×4=24060 \times 4 = 240
  • Multiply the Denominators: 22×2=4422 \times 2 = 44
  • Form the New Fraction: 6022×24=24044\frac{60}{22} \times \frac{2}{4} = \frac{240}{44}

Let's Simplify 24044\frac{240}{44}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 240240 and 4444. The GCD of 240240 and 4444 is 44.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:240÷444÷4=6011\frac{240 \div 4}{44 \div 4} = \frac{60}{11}

Answer 6022÷24=6011\frac{60}{22}\div\frac{2}{4} = \frac{60}{11}
